🌟 What is Fabricord?

Fabricord is a Fabric-based alternative to DiscordSRV, designed to seamlessly bridge Minecraft server chat with Discord channels.

🔥 Why Use Fabricord?

Sync chats between your Fabric server and Discord effortlessly
Lightweight & Optimized – No unnecessary bloat, just what you need
Modern, visually appealing message style
Easy user mentions system – Supports role & user ID tagging
Death & achievement notifications to Discord


📥 Installation Guide

Setting up Fabricord is quick and easy:

  1. Install the mod on your Fabric server and start it once
    • A configuration file (config.yml) will be auto-generated
  2. Edit config.yml in server-root/fabricord
    • Enter your BotToken & LogChannelID
  3. Restart your server, and you're good to go! 🎉
